Understanding Financial Incentives for Solar Installation
When you're considering solar installment, comprehending the financial rewards offered can make a substantial distinction in your decision.
Federal tax credits, for instance, let you subtract a percent of your planetary system's expense from your tax obligations, which can significantly reduce your upfront expenditures. Many states additionally supply refunds, minimizing the general price also better.
In addition, neighborhood energy companies could offer rewards for solar fostering, like performance-based motivations or net metering credit scores. These programs can help you recoup your investment much faster.
Do not forget to inspect if your location has real estate tax exemptions for solar setups, as this can save you money over time.
Benefiting from these incentives can make solar power more budget-friendly and enticing.
Assessing Seasonal Effect On Power Production
Recognizing the monetary motivations can help you make a much more informed decision about solar installation, yet it's also important to take into consideration exactly how seasonal adjustments affect energy production.
solar panels generate one of the most energy during sunny months, usually springtime and summer season, when daytime hours are much longer and sunshine is a lot more intense. On the other hand, wintertime can bring decreased result due to much shorter days and cloud cover.
However, even in chillier months, solar panels can still produce power, particularly if they're clear of snow. You must evaluate your regional environment and the alignment of your panels to maximize performance.
This seasonal variation effects not just power production however additionally your roi, so it's essential to intend appropriately.
